7 facts about this song
Release and Reception"(There's Gotta Be) More to Life" was released on May 20, 2003, as the second single from Stacie Orrico's self-titled second studio album.
- The song received positive reviews from music critics, who praised Orrico's vocals and the song's inspirational message.
|
Chart PerformanceThis song was quite successful globally. It reached the top five in three countries and the top twenty in ten.
- In the United States, the song peaked at number 30 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art.
- In the United Kingdom, it managed to reach number 12, while in Australia and New Zealand, it climbed to the top 5.
|
Song CompositionThe song has a pop and R&B music style.
- The song was written by Sabelle Breer, Kevin Kadish, Harvey Mason Jr., Damon Thomas, and Lucy Woodward.
- It lasts for three minutes and twenty-one seconds.
|
Music VideoThe music video, directed by Dave Meyers, depicts Orrico in different life scenarios including a waitress, a ballerina, a college student, an assistant, and a movie star, showing that there's more to life than these superficial roles.
- The video was quite popular on MTV's Total Request Live, where it spent 21 days on the countdown.
|
Critical Reception"(There's Gotta Be) More to Life" is often considered one of Orrico's signature songs.
- It garnered her the Dove Award for Pop/Contemporary Recorded Song of the Year in 2004.
|
Song MeaningThe song's lyrics discuss the emptiness of material possessions and how there's more to life than just earthly pleasures.
- It sends out a powerful message about looking beyond the mundane and superficial aspects of life to find true fulfillment and happiness.
|
Impact on Orrico's CareerThis song helped establish Orrico as a popular up-and-coming young artist in the early 2000s.
- It boosted the sales of her album "Stacie Orrico," which has sold over 3.5 million copies worldwide.
